I’m fairly certain that different women have different things they do before going on a date with a guy. Some may dance around the house a little bit, some may take a shot of patron/vodka/a mixed drink to calm their nerves, and some may even say a small prayer for the evening to go off without a hitch. But what I’m also fairly certain about is the fact that if the girl really likes this dude, chances are she’s definitely taking a lot of time trying to perfect her best casually cute fit.

You know that outfit, right? The one that makes men think ‘oh she just pulled this out of her closet, and yet she’s so fly. Yep, she’s effortlessly fly.’ (If men said things like ‘effortlessly fly’ that is…) Riiight, that one. The one that took her 20 outfits and 10 pairs of shoes later to finally get to. The effortless one.

The beautiful thing that has significantly helped many women in this area is technology, though. While we still don’t have Judy Jeston’s closet where one can walk in and walk out perfectly styled in less than a minute (ugh!), we do now have things like camera phones and Skype. And when you mix camera phones/Skype with a girl preparing for a date, chances are you’ll get something like this:
